What Is Laminated Automotive Glass?

Laminated automotive glass Laminated automotive glass is primarily used for windshields. It is created by laminating two layers of glass with a strong plastic layer between the two. This plastic is known as polyvinyl butyral (PVB).

Uses – The lamination of glass and plastic makes laminated glass highly durable and less susceptible to breaking. It may fracture, but it does not break into sharp shards like regular glass. This can be seen as one of the reasons for using laminated glass in vehicles.

How Laminated Glass Is Made

The method of otbtaining the laminated glass is as follows:

Two pieces of glass are cut to size.

PVB (a thin plastic layer) is inserted between the layers.

Hot and dense, these pieces of glass and plastic are pressed together.

The result is a sharp, strong and bendable sheet that can absorb a blow.

This design is meant to help keep the pane together even in heavy accidents, leading to lower risk of injury to occupants within the vehicle.

The Ways Laminated Auto Glass Keeps Drivers Safe

Shatterproof car glass is a layered safety material which can protect drivers on different levels. Let’s examine each of those more closely.

Prevents Shattering During Accidents

One of the most significant advantage of Laminated glass is, it does not shatter into sharp pieces. In the event of a collision:

The glass will crack but remain mostly intact.

The plastic layer keeps the pieces in place.

Shattered glass is notorious to cause cuts to both drivers and passengers.

Ordinary glass can shatter into hundreds of dangerous pieces, injuring the patient. Laminated glass minimizes this potential.

Protection against ejection from the vehicle

In the of a severe accident, passengers can be ejected from the vehicle if windshields shatter. Laminated glass is essentially a barrier that keeps passengers inside the vehicle.

This is crucial because being inside the vehicle during an accident increases chances of survival. The tough plastic layer of laminated glass prevents the windshield from splintering if it should shatter, allowing time for seat belts and air bags to swing into action.

Protection against road hazards and weather

Cars encounter pebbles, gravel and small rocks on the road while driving. Drivers are shielded by laminated glass in a few ways:

Prevents little rocks from getting into your car.

Prevents cracks from spreading across the windshield.

Provides added protection against the rain, hail and wind.

This keeps the driver's sight clear, and preventing potential dangerous accidents due to insufficient visibility.

Reduces Noise Inside the Vehicle

And laminated glass has acoustic advantages. The plastic layer may help absorb some noise from outside, like street or construction sounds. This makes the interior of the car quieter and more comfortable, leading to better driver concentration on the road.

Safety Features Beyond Impact Protection

Laminated automotive glass isn’t only about accident protection. It also has some other features that add to its safety and convenience.

UV Ray Protection

The plastic interlayer of laminated glass can filter out most harmful ultraviolet (UV) rays from those of the sun. This ensures that drivers and passengers are guarded against:

Sun-related skin damage from exposure to the sun over time.

Discoloration of interior (seats, dash).

Laminated glass serves a purpose of health and up-keeping of the vehicle by shielding UV rays.

Fire Resistance

Laminated glass is more fire resistant than normal glass. The plastic door layer can survive a more intense heat longer, slowing any rare spread of flames inside a car.

Anti-Theft Benefits

Laminated glass also creates obstacles for car thieves. Or even if someone tries to swing a sledgehammer at the windshield, the glass is resistant to being penetrated quickly. This is an added security for cars parked in public places.

Laminated Glass or Tempered Glass – Which Option Is Superior

There are two major types of safety glass used in cars, laminated and tempered glass. Though both enhance safety, laminate is beneficial to the windshield for:

Due to these advantages, laminated glass is used commonly in windshields, and tempered glass is frequently selected for rear and side windows.

Tricks for Maintaining Laminated Auto Glass

Laminated glass may be tough, but it needs to be looked after to ensure safety. Here are some tips:

Regularly clean: Wipe the glass with a soft cloth and mild detergent. Don’t use strong cleaning agents that can crack the plastic covering.

Look for chips: Even tiny imperfections should be repaired to keep them from worsening.

Replace if broken: The laminated glass should be replaced once it has a significant crack or the piece is shattered.
